    Here is your revised ad. I listed most of the words that you had provided. You came up with a lot of words! If a person uses too many keywords that are visible in an ad, it can make things look sloppy and unprofessional to some people. You can use as many words as you want to in the hidden parts of your website that you know will get picked up by the search engines.

    Usually people aren't going to be looking for a business by the Zip Code or Area Code. Most of my ads don't have that, but some of them do. For you, just starting with extensive advertising on the Internet, I thought that we could give it a try and see how it works.

    I've put fictitious words and locations in your ad and I've already done a "spill chick" LOL :) for the ad, but you'll be wanting to double-check things anyway after you've done the deletions and names of places substitutions.

    Please let me know here the time that you posted the ad. If you have any difficulties on hoobly.com, please let me know. If there's too many capital letters in an ad, then hoobly.com will sometimes automatically make everything lower-case.
